Question 278354: find an equation for the line

You can put this solution on YOUR website! A vertical line has an undefined slope. Every point on a vertical line has the same x coordinate value.
This line has an x coordinate of -7 (since the point (-7, -4) is on the line).

Let's plot that point and draw that vertical line through it:
Let's look at some more points on that vertical line
What do you notice about all those points? You notice that they
all have the same x-coordinate, which is -7. So the equation is
"the line every point of which has x-coordinate = -7"
or writing that sentence much shorter, we have
x = -7
that is the equation of that vertical line. You just write
what x (the x-coordinate) is always equal to on that line.
